DEBRA BROWNING MARCKRES

Share article

BROOKFIELD – Debra Browning Marckres, age 68, of Brookfield, passed away on March 10. She was born in Orange, Va., and said that “her cause of death was living life, and that it was inevitable”. She is survived by her husband, Henry Marckres of Brookfield, her son, Eric (Christina) Browning, her sister Pamela (Herbert) Merritt, and granddaughter Kate Browning. Donations in lieu of flowers will be appreciated at the Central Vermont Humane Society. “And now, through all the pages of my days, I have reached the end of my story, and with satisfaction, softly close the book.”
